OHSU Vaginoplasty Booklet (2025)

Produced by Oregon Health & Science University (OHSU), this is a comprehensive, patient-centered guide to gender-affirming vaginoplasty. It walks patients through every stage of the process, from preparation and hospitalization to long-term care, with an emphasis on informed decision-making, emotional readiness, and sustained well-being. Key features include:

  • Clear overview of surgical procedures, risks, and complications to help patients make informed choices and understand recovery expectations.
  • Step-by-step preparation resources, including checklists, supply guides, and planning worksheets for surgery scheduling, support systems, and post-operative care.
  • Detailed information on hospital stay and recovery, featuring daily schedules, movement and massage exercises, discharge instructions, and symptom tracking tools.
  • Post-surgical care guidance, covering dilation, douching, pain management, urinary and bowel care, scar massage, and long-term vaginal health.
  • Practical tools for success, such as letter of support templates, pain and dilation tracking tables, and resources for caregiver involvement.
  • Holistic support resources, including crisis lines, fertility preservation guidance, and the OHSU Transgender Health Program’s education class schedule.

Facial Feminization Surgery: A Guide for the Transgender Woman

Thinking About Facial Feminization Surgery? For many transgender women, refining facial features can be a deeply affirming part of their transition, often viewed as one of the most meaningful steps toward aligning appearance with gender identity. If you’re transfeminine and feel that features such as a strong jawline, pronounced brow, or prominent chin don’t reflect how you see yourself, facial feminization surgery may help your outward look better match your inner self.

Renowned FFS surgeons Jordan Deschamps-Braly, M.D., and Douglas K. Ousterhout, M.D. are leaders in the field of craniofacial feminization, a specialized branch of plastic surgery focused on creating softer, more traditionally feminine facial contours. In Facial Feminization, they describe a range of procedures, including scalp advancement, forehead contouring, jaw tapering, chin reshaping, cheek and temple enhancement, tracheal shave, nose and lip reshaping, and hair transplantation.

This comprehensive guide also features over two hundred FFS before-and-after photographs, illustrating the transformative results and diverse possibilities of FFS. Get it here »
